Hi all, just removed a radiator while decorating. One side was easy, the other just spun round and is now leaking. Have drained down system but not sure how to fix leak (not seen this connector before) ps was really tight - split the olive? The whole connector is spinning round.

Thanks in advance.
20230528_124456.jpg
 
So it measures 8mm od just above the paint ?
 
Was the valve a trv ?
 
Yes snap reducer

You need to remove all the water from the pipe before soldering

You will need an 8mm coupling, short bit of 8mm pipe and either a 3 part reducer 8-15mm or a soldered 8-15mm reducer and a 15mm olive
